Transaction 5d63a0248385ce1db9a5d5a6ebd303f0dbbbb6eb84697694e21daf98c5c0001b
1 Input
1 Output
-
5d63a0248385ce1db9a5d5a6ebd303f0dbbbb6eb84697694e21daf98c5c0001b:0
- value
- 6862657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c3eb9878aee8c5a082c9ca158e4b47ef9bfd78d OP_EQUAL
- address
- 37BZcF6XcPxLXKUcnBP6nd5cQ3FundY6yk